The Comprehensive Guide to Buying Shipping Containers
Shipping containers have transcended their standard role in the logistics industry, emerging as flexible solutions for storage, interior areas, and more. Their resilience, price, and special structural benefits make them appealing for numerous applications, from homes and offices to popup stores and community tasks. This post provides a detailed take a look at the elements to think about when buying shipping containers, the types available, prospective usages, and answering often asked questions.
Why Consider Buying Shipping Containers?
Shipping containers use numerous distinct benefits, including:

When aiming to buy shipping containers, numerous types are readily available, each serving distinct requirements. Below is a table laying out the most typical types of shipping containers and their attributes:
TypeDimensions (L x W x H)Key FeaturesSuitable UsesRequirement Dry Container20ft/ 40ftStandard weather defenseStorage, shipping itemsHigh Cube Container20ft/ 40ftAdditional height (1ft taller than requirement)Taller products, stackable storageRefrigerated Container20ft/ 40ftTemperature-controlledDisposable itemsOpen Top Container20ft/ 40ftOpenable roof for tall cargoBulk materials, oversized itemsFlat Rack Container20ft/ 40ftNo sides or roofing, easy loadingHeavy machinery, carsDouble Door Container20ft/ 40ftDoors on both ends for ease of accessQuick loading/unloadingElements to Consider When Buying Shipping Containers
Function and Usage: Determine what you need the container for-- storage, shipping, housing, and so on. This will affect the type and condition of the container you should acquire.

New vs. Used: New containers are more pricey however use better durability and looks. Used containers can be significantly more affordable however might need repair and maintenance.

Size Requirements: Choose a size that lines up with your requirements. Basic alternatives include 20ft and 40ft containers, but bigger or smaller sizes might be available upon request.

Shipping and Logistics: Consider logistics costs beyond the purchase price. This includes transportation, packing, discharging, and any necessary authorizations for delivery.

Condition: Inspect the container for any damage or rust. Demand documents or photos from the seller to verify condition before buying.

Customization: Depending on planned use, you might want to personalize the container for included performance. This might consist of electrical installations, insulation, or window cutouts.

Local Regulations: Research regional zoning laws and regulations concerning using shipping containers in your location.
FAQs About Buying Shipping Containers1. Are shipping containers waterproof?
Yes, Shipping Container Dimensions containers are developed to be water resistant and can secure the contents from rain. Nevertheless, the door seals and general condition of the container might impact water resistance.
2. Can I fund a shipping container?
Many providers offer funding options for buying shipping containers. Make sure to compare interest rates and terms before devoting.
3. Is a shipping container worth the investment?
Yes, the versatility and sturdiness of a shipping container generally supply long-lasting value, whether for storage, business usage, or as a home.
4. How do I transport my shipping container?
A lot of companies offer delivery services for shipping Intermodal Containers, however you can also work with professional transport services to move containers.
5. What modifications can I make to a shipping container?
You can personalize shipping Conex Containers in different methods, consisting of setting up windows, doors, insulation, and electrical systems, depending upon your planned usage.

When it pertains to buying shipping containers, numerous sources are available:

Direct from Manufacturer: This alternative usually offers the best prices, but it might need a bigger preliminary financial investment.

Shipping Container Suppliers: Local or online specialized suppliers can supply new and used containers, frequently with modification alternatives.

Auctions and Liquidation Sales: Purchasing containers from auctions can be inexpensive, however buyers must be cautious regarding the container's condition.

Classified Ads: Websites like Craigslist and local classified advertisements can offer excellent deals on used containers.

Shipping Companies: Some shipping companies offer surplus containers, typically at competitive prices.
